Technology and Infrastructure

The foundational difference between RippleNet and SWIFT lies in their technological frameworks. SWIFT (Society for Worldwide Interbank Financial Telecommunication) operates as a messaging network established in the 1970s. It connects over 11,000 financial institutions worldwide, allowing them to exchange payment instructions securely. However, SWIFT does not handle actual fund transfers; it relies on correspondent banking networks for settlement, which can introduce delays and complexities.

Speed and Transaction Efficiency

Transaction speed is a critical factor where RippleNet demonstrates significant advantages over SWIFT. Traditional SWIFT payments can take one to five business days to settle due to multi-tiered correspondent banking processes. These delays stem from time zone differences, manual compliance checks, and intermediary involvement.

Frequently Asked Questions

What is the primary difference between RippleNet and SWIFT?
RippleNet is a blockchain-based payment network that enables real-time settlement and uses XRP for liquidity, while SWIFT is a messaging system that relies on correspondent banks for fund transfers, often resulting in slower transactions.

How does RippleNet’s use of XRP benefit cross-border payments?
XRP acts as a bridge currency, allowing instant conversion between fiat currencies. This reduces the need for pre-funded accounts, lowers costs, and speeds up transactions, making it efficient for international transfers.

Is SWIFT becoming obsolete due to RippleNet?
Not immediately. SWIFT’s extensive network and entrenched presence in global banking give it staying power. However, RippleNet’s technological advantages are attracting institutions seeking faster, cheaper alternatives, positioning it as a viable competitor.

Can RippleNet operate without XRP?
Yes, RippleNet can facilitate payments without XRP using traditional pre-funding methods. However, using XRP through ODL enhances efficiency, reduces costs, and provides greater scalability for liquidity management.

What are the regulatory challenges facing RippleNet?
RippleNet faces scrutiny from regulators regarding the classification of XRP and compliance with financial laws. Overcoming these hurdles is essential for broader institutional adoption and integration into mainstream finance.
